1、概述
静态文件是指在WEB
应用中的图像文件、
CSS
文件、
Javascript文件。需要再settings.py
中,完成如下的配置如下:
STATICFILES_DIRS = [
BASE_DIR , 'static',
]
STATIC_URL = '/static/'
其中:
- STATICFILES_DIRS列表用于指定静态文件在服务器的存储位置,如果指定了多个路径,在访问静态文件时将依次进行查找。
- STATIC_URL是指访问静态文件时要使用的URL
2、访问静态文件
访问静态文件时需要以下两步:
第一步:在模板文件中加载static ,语法结构为: {% load static %} (必须放在前面)
第二步:访问静态文件,语法结构为:
<link rel="stylesheet" href="{% static 'styles/reset.css' %}">
<img src="{% static 'images/logo.png' %}">
<script src="{% static 'scripts/common.js' %}">